World of Warcraft Blue Post: Death Knight set effect changed

World of Warcraft Blue Post: Death Knight set effect changed

evil:

2-piece set of rewards: Every 5 Scourge Strikes/Shadow Claws Cast a Soul Harvest on your target and summon a ghoul for 12 seconds.

4-piece set of rewards: Soul Harvest increases the damage your pet deals by 20%. If the Soul Reaper secondary effect is triggered, all your pets receive a 20% damage bonus.

austerity:

2-piece set of rewards: Get a rune with a 15% chance to trigger the Killing Machine. Consuming the Killing Machine increases your strength by 2% for 6 seconds.

Hey, guys! Similar to Stalker, I feel like The Death Knight would have enjoyed the follow-up post from last week's update to see some of January's changes as a winter gift to make up for not seeing iterations and bug fixes on PTR this week.

For the two rewards we're presenting today, try to give feedback around your impressions of them on a sensory level; both the Evil and Frost 2-piece sets have generated a lot of discussion about their actual power levels at this point, so these iterations try to solve these problems while grasping the original goal of the set design.

While we think the rewards for interacting with Soul Reaper still have their value and excitement and drive the evil single-objective/slash positioning (compared to Frost), it's clear that the entire reward is inactive unless it's during the slash period, which can lead to some major adjustment issues. The set of equipment attempts to preserve this goal, while also underscoring the illusion that the evil of the initial promise is the "Undead Commander".

Before anyone asks, yes, all pets mean ghouls, gargoyles, optical sighting giants, your name, crazy about it.

The reward is a bit experimental for Frost, so really want to see what people think – again, the numbers may be too high/too low, don't let me point symbols.

The above bonus is intended to achieve the goal of the previous one, which is to "generate more killing machine processes for the 4-piece set", but it feels more like it is in your hands. Here, getting runes is meant as part of being gifted and passive
